This position is responsible for all plant operations, production and performance through planning, coordinating, and evaluating the activities of the management team and employees. The Plant Manager is accountable for ensuring production quality and safety standards throughout the facility. The Plant Manager works with Corporate Engineering, Manufacturing Operations and Materials Management, Finance/Accounting and Sales Departments to ensure the production of the "right products" in a timely manner and at cost effective means. Participates in Company planning and budgeting by maintaining plant budgets. Works with the VP of Health and Safety to ensure safety of plant employees and production processes. Supervises, directs and develops staff who perform the following tasks.

DUTIES
Work with Production Manager and front-line plant supervisors to:
Develop, monitor, and adjust production schedules to align with customer demand;
Monitor and adjust production techniques for safety, throughput, standardization, and quality; identify improvement opportunities & create action plans;
Coordinate production strategies;
Co-own accountability for inventory and supply opportunities; influence supply chain partners and internal team to resolve relevant issues;
Monitor the quality of incoming materials (resin, accessories, etc.);
Monitor the quality of finished products;
Ensure material requirements and planning are coordinated with production needs;
Implement and manage continuous improvement initiatives and activities;
